Panigaon
Panigaon is a village located in Junagarh tehsil of Kalahandi district in Odisha,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Junagarh (tehsildar office) and 34km away from district headquarter Bhawanipatna. As per 2009 stats, Bhainriguda is the gram panchayat of Panigaon village.

About Panigaon
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Panigaon is 423697. The village spans a total geographical area of 199 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 766014. Junagarh is nearest town to Panigaon village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.

Population of Panigaon
According to the 2011 Census, Panigaon has a total population of about 608, with approximately 300 males and 308 females. The sex ratio is around 1026 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 94 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 65 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 61. The overall literacy rate is approximately 48.68%, with male literacy at about 63.33% and female literacy near 34.42%. There are around 153 households in the village. Connectivity of Panigaon
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Panigaon. As per the 2011 stats, Panigaon had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
